FAQ: How do we run schema migrations on Brundle without downtime? Short answer: expand-then-contract. Add new columns behind the Ostrey feature gate, dual-write from both code paths, backfill with the Lanthem batch runner, then drop old columns only after two clean release cycles. Future maintainers: never run the contract step during a Veldwick traffic peak, and always snapshot the migration ledger first. If the ledger vault has sealed itself between releases, reopen it using the recovery passphrase below.

unlock words, kawig-bawef: belax-sorir-druax-ulaiel-wenael-belael

Subject: Handover — Poolwright release duties

Hi Maret,

Taking over Poolwright releases means watching the connection pool limits closely: staging caps at 40, production at 200, and any migration that holds connections must be flagged in the release notes. Rollbacks require re-signing the prior artifact. The deploy key you will need is pasted below.

rollout seal: bky4_x7Gc

Handover note — Dara to Felix

Felix, as I step back from the Corvale file, here's where things stand: the Brightloom acquisition talks are warm but not closed. Sales leads should keep pipeline conversations neutral for now. Diligence wraps mid-quarter. Before you brief the team, read the confidential note below.

internal memo for kawip-hadug: Headcount on the Wenwyn team goes from 7 to 140 by the end of January. Gross margin on Wenwyn came in at 20 percent against a plan of 15 percent.

## Runbook: MemTrace GPU Profiler v1.4

Builds the MemTrace profiling agent for the Quillbrook render fleet. Steps: pull `release/1.4`, run `make agent`, verify allocation-snapshot tests pass, check the overhead benchmark stays under 3%. Do not enable live-capture mode in prod — staging only. Artifacts go to the internal Drennax registry after signing. Contractors: get approval from the tooling lead before promotion. Sign the agent bundle with the deploy key below.

deploy key for kajof-fajop: bky6_gDHw9Q